Long-term Exposure Effects
Repeated or prolonged contact may cause skin sensitization.

Expert Verdict

🚨🚨 DO NOT USE IN COSMETICS. SVHC on ECHA Candidate List. Endocrine disruptor (environmental + human health concern). Releases 4-nonylphenol (estrogenic). Classified Repr. 2 (suspected reproductive toxicant). Aquatic Acute 1 + Chronic 1. ANSES evaluation ongoing for further restriction. Incompatible with any clean beauty, COSMOS, or ECOCERT standard
